汉江流域三生空间转型格局及其生态环境效应

汉江流域在我国区域生态安全和经济社会发展格局中的战略地位日益凸显,开展三生空间用转型及其生态环境效应研究能为该区生态文明建设和国土空间规划提供参考。基于 1990-2020年土地利用/覆盖数据和"生产—生活—生态"(三生空间)视角,运用转移矩阵、生态贡献率等研究方法,分析了汉江流域三生空间用地转型及其生态环境效应的时空演变特征。结果表明:1990-2020年汉江流域以生态空间为主,生态空间面积先减后增且集中分布在丹江口以上流域,生产空间由增转减,生活空间始终处于增加态势;1990-2020年汉江流域三生空间类型转移关系保持稳定,以生态空间和生产空间的互转为主,转移规模呈先减后增趋势;汉江流域生态环境质量呈西高东低空间格局,高质量区面积持续增加,其他质量区不同程度下降;影响汉江流域生态环境改善、恶化的主导用地类型分别为生产空间转化为林地绿色和蓝色生态空间,草地及林地绿色、蓝色生态空间转化为生产空间。
Spatial transformation pattern of ecological-production-living spaces and its eco-environmental effects in Hanjiang River Basin
The Hanjiang River Basin plays an increasingly prominent strategic position in the pattern of regional ecological security and economic and social development in China.The study on the transformation of three life spaces and its ecological environmental effect can provide a reference for the construction of ecological civilization and territorial spatial planning in this area.Based on the land use/cover data from 1990 to 2020 and the perspective of"production-life-ecology",this paper analyzes the spatial and temporal evolution of land use transformation and its ecological environmental effects in the Hanjiang River Basin by using the transfer matrix and ecological contribution rate.The results showed that from 1990 to 2020,the Han River basin was dominated by ecological space,the ecological space area decreased first and then increased,and the ecological space was concentrated in the basin above Danjiangkou.The production space changes from increasing to decreasing,and the living space is always increasing.The transfer relationship of the 3 species space type in the Hanjiang River Basin remained stable,mainly the mutual transfer of ecological space and production space,and the transfer scale showed a trend of decreasing at first and then increasing.The ecological environment quality of the Hanjiang River Basin showed a spatial pattern of higher in the west and lower in the east.The area of the high-quality area continued to increase,while the area of other quality areas decreased to different degrees.The main land types affecting the improvement and deterioration of the ecological environment in the Hanjiang River Basin were the conversion of production space into forest green and blue ecological space,and the conversion of grassland and forest green and blue ecological space into production space.
